Kinds of Child Care Alternatives

There are lots of kinds of child care solutions, each catering to various age groups and schedules. Several of the most common forms of child care choices consist of:

  1. Daycare Centers: Daycare facilities are facilities that offer look after young ones of various centuries, typically from infancy to preschool. These facilities are licensed and managed because of the condition, making certain they meet specific requirements for safety, cleanliness, and staff skills. Daycare centers offer organized activities, meals, and direction for the kids in a group setting.

  1. Family Child Care Homes: Family child care homes are little, home-based child care facilities operate by one caregiver or a small group of caregivers. These providers offer an even more individualized and family-like environment for kids, with fewer young ones in care in comparison to daycare facilities. Family child care domiciles can offer flexible hours and prices, making them a well known option for moms and dads who need much more personalized care for their child.

  1. Preschools: Preschools are academic organizations offering early childhood knowledge for children usually between the centuries of 2 to 5 years old. These programs give attention to preparing young ones for preschool by exposing them to basic educational principles, social abilities, and emotional development. Preschools usually are powered by a school-year schedule and provide part-time or full time alternatives for moms and dads.

  1. Before and After class Programs: Before and after college programs are made to provide maintain school-aged children through the hours pre and post the regular school time. These programs provide many different activities, research help, and supervision for children while moms and dads have reached work. Before and after school programs are generally offered by schools, community facilities, or private companies.

  1. Nanny or Au Pair: Nannies and au sets tend to be individuals who supply in-home childcare services for people. Nannies in many cases are skilled experts who offer full time look after children within the family's home, while au pairs are young adults from foreign countries whom reside because of the household and supply social exchange alongside childcare. Nannies and au pairs offer personalized care and flexibility in scheduling for parents.

Things to consider Whenever Choosing Childcare

When selecting child care near you, it's important to give consideration to a number of aspects to ensure you find an excellent and appropriate choice for your youngster. A few of the key factors to think about consist of:

  1. Licensing and Accreditation: it is vital to choose a licensed and accredited child care supplier, because ensures that the facility meets certain standards for protection, cleanliness, staff skills, and system quality. Certification and accreditation display that provider has actually encountered a rigorous evaluation procedure and it is committed to maintaining high standards of treatment.

  1. Team Qualifications and Training: The qualifications and instruction of the staff during the childcare center are very important in offering high quality care for kids. Seek providers who have trained and skilled caregivers, and staff who are certified in CPR and first-aid. Staff-to-child ratios are crucial, while they determine the amount of attention and direction that each and every kid obtains.

  1. Curriculum and plan strategies: look at the curriculum and system activities provided by the kid care provider, while they play a significant part inside development and discovering of your child. Look for programs that provide age-appropriate activities, educational possibilities, and possibilities for socialization. A well-rounded curriculum that includes play, art, songs, and outside time can donate to your child's total development.

  1. Health and Safety Policies: make sure the child attention supplier has strict safe practices guidelines set up to guard the well-being of one's son or daughter. Search for facilities that follow correct health techniques, have actually secure entry and exit processes, and keep on a clean and child-friendly environment. Ask about disaster processes, disease policies, and how the supplier handles accidents or situations.

  1. Parent Involvement and Communication: Select a young child care supplier that encourages moms and dad participation and keeps available communication with families. Search for providers that provide opportunities for parents to be involved in activities, occasions, and group meetings, including regular changes on the kid's progress and well being. A solid partnership between parents and caregivers can cause an optimistic and supporting childcare knowledge.
